Don’t Interrupt My Show! and Other Consumer Concerns with Interactive Streaming

Interactive streaming sounds great on the face of it—lean-forward experiences offer levels of engagement that passive viewing can’t compete with. However, according to Parks AssociatesJennifer Kent, survey data reveals that consumers have privacy concerns, don’t want their shows interrupted, and voice other likes and dislikes regarding interactive streams.

“When we're asking consumers what they think about interactive TV experiences, we certainly want to understand [their concerns],” Kent says. “What's their fear? What's their concern? The number one thing is the privacy and security of their personal data and also payment information. So, we're talking about commercial experiences here. You're trusting perhaps a new entity with your payment information. A lot of these subscription services already have your billing information, so there are some services that you're already trusting there, but how is that [new] payment going to work?”
